Pre-heat oven to 400F
Place tomatillos, jalapeno, yellow onion, and garlic on a sheet pan and place in the oven for 10-12 minutes to get some roast color on the vegetables.
Combine the roasted veggies in a food processor and pulse until you have a chunky consistency.
In a large skillet, add Oaxaca cheese and PuraVida Fajita Rajas.
Bake for about 10-12 minutes until cheese is golden brown and melted.
Remove skillet from oven, top with roasted salsa verde and serve with warm flour tortillas. Enjoy!
